How To Use Unalterable in Sentences?
To use “Unalterable” in a sentence, start by identifying a situation or concept that cannot be changed or modified. For example, you could talk about a fact, a rule, a law of nature, or a permanent characteristic.
Here is an example sentence using “Unalterable”:
“The laws of physics dictate that time always moves forward in an unalterable manner, regardless of human efforts to control it.”
In this sentence, the word “Unalterable” is used to describe the unchanging nature of the laws of physics regarding the direction of time.
When incorporating “Unalterable” into your own sentences, remember to consider the context and ensure that the word accurately conveys the idea of something that is fixed, immutable, or cannot be altered. It is important to use the word in a way that highlights the quality of being unchangeable or permanent.
